How much does website migration cost?

Knowledge Base > Migration > How much does website migration cost?

Website migration costs can vary significantly based on several factors, ranging from the size and complexity of the website to the specific goals and requirements of the migration. Here’s a breakdown of key considerations to help you understand the potential costs associated with website migration.

1. Size and Complexity of the Website:

  • The size and complexity of your website play a crucial role in determining migration costs. Smaller, simpler websites with fewer pages and functionalities generally require less effort and resources, resulting in lower costs. On the other hand, larger websites with intricate structures, extensive content, and complex functionalities may involve more time and resources, leading to higher costs.

2. Type of Migration:

  • The type of migration you’re undertaking significantly influences costs. Common types of migrations include:
    • Platform Migration: Moving from one content management system (CMS) to another.
    • Hosting Migration: Transferring the website to a new hosting provider.
    • Domain Migration: Changing the website’s domain name.
    • CMS Version Upgrade: Updating to a newer version of the existing CMS.

3. Technical Requirements:

  • The technical requirements of the migration can impact costs. For instance, if the migration involves custom-coded functionalities, extensive databases, or complex integrations, additional technical expertise and resources may be required, leading to higher costs.

4. Testing and Quality Assurance:

  • Thorough testing is a crucial step in website migration to identify and address any issues before going live. The costs associated with testing, quality assurance, and resolving potential issues depend on the comprehensiveness of the testing process. Rigorous testing may incur higher costs but is essential for a seamless migration.

5. SEO Considerations:

  • Maintaining or improving SEO rankings is a critical aspect of website migration. Implementing 301 redirects, updating sitemaps, and addressing SEO-related issues contribute to the overall cost. SEO experts may be involved to ensure that the migration doesn’t negatively impact search engine rankings.

6. Professional Services:

  • Hiring professional services, such as web developers, designers, and SEO experts, can contribute to the overall cost. The level of expertise required depends on the complexity of the migration and the specific goals you aim to achieve.

7. Backup and Rollback Strategy:

  • Implementing a robust backup and rollback strategy is essential for risk mitigation. The costs associated with creating reliable backups, ensuring data integrity, and having a contingency plan for potential rollbacks contribute to the overall migration cost.

8. Post-Migration Support and Optimization:

  • After the migration is complete, ongoing support and optimization efforts may be necessary. Addressing post-migration issues, optimizing performance, and fine-tuning the website to ensure a smooth user experience contribute to the overall cost.

Conclusion:

Website migration costs are multifaceted and depend on the unique characteristics of your website and the goals of the migration. It’s advisable to conduct a thorough assessment of your website’s size, complexity, and specific requirements to estimate costs accurately. Engaging with experienced professionals and allocating resources for testing and post-migration optimization are crucial elements in ensuring a successful and cost-effective website migration.

Common Questions

  • How much does a typical website migration cost?

    The cost of website migration varies based on factors like website size, complexity, and the type of migration. Small to medium-sized websites with straightforward migrations may cost between $1,000 to $5,000, while larger or more complex migrations can range from $5,000 to $20,000 or more. It’s crucial to assess your specific needs for a more accurate estimate.

  • Can I migrate my website on a tight budget?

    Yes, it’s possible to migrate a website on a budget, especially if it’s a small or relatively simple website. Utilize DIY tools provided by hosting providers or content management systems, but be cautious with complex migrations. Budget for essential components like testing, backups, and potential post-migration adjustments to ensure a successful and cost-effective migration.

  • What factors contribute the most to migration costs?

    The primary factors influencing migration costs include the size and complexity of the website, the type of migration (platform, hosting, domain, etc.), technical requirements, extensive testing, SEO considerations, and the need for professional services. Each of these factors contributes to the overall complexity and time investment, affecting the cost.

  • Are there ongoing costs after the migration is complete?

    Yes, there may be ongoing costs post-migration. These can include post-migration support, addressing any unforeseen issues, optimizing website performance, and ongoing SEO efforts. It’s advisable to budget for these considerations to ensure the sustained success of your website after the migration.

  • Can I perform a website migration myself to save costs?

    DIY website migration is possible, especially for smaller websites with less complexity. Many hosting providers and content management systems offer user-friendly migration tools. However, for larger or more intricate migrations, involving professionals is recommended to avoid potential issues and ensure a smooth transition.

  • How can I get an accurate cost estimate for my website migration?

    To get an accurate cost estimate, assess your website’s size, complexity, and specific migration requirements. Consult with professionals, obtain quotes from service providers, and factor in costs for testing, backup strategies, and potential post-migration adjustments. A detailed understanding of your website’s nuances will contribute to a more precise cost estimate.

Related Articles